2. Best Hypoallergenic Couches for Allergies

When it comes to choosing a hypoallergenic couch, there are a few key features to look for. First and foremost, the fabric should be made from natural, hypoallergenic materials such as organic cotton, linen, or microfiber. These materials are less likely to trap allergens and are easier to clean.

Additionally, look for couches that have removable, washable covers or cushions. This makes it easier to regularly clean and remove any allergens that may have accumulated on the surface. Some couches even come with anti-microbial treatments to further prevent the growth of allergens.

The Problem with Standard Couches

living room couches hypoallergenic

Standard couches are typically made with materials that can trigger allergies in individuals who are sensitive to dust, mold, and pet dander. These materials include synthetic fabrics, foam, and glue, which can release chemicals and irritants into the air. Additionally, dust and allergens can easily accumulate on the surface of a standard couch, making it difficult to keep clean.

The Benefits of Hypoallergenic Couches

living room couches hypoallergenic

Hypoallergenic couches , on the other hand, are specifically designed to minimize the risk of allergic reactions. They are made with natural, organic materials such as cotton, wool, and latex, which are less likely to trigger allergies. These materials are also more breathable, reducing the build-up of moisture and mold. Additionally, hypoallergenic couches are often treated with special coatings that make them resistant to dust and other allergens.

Moreover, hypoallergenic couches are easier to keep clean. They can be vacuumed and wiped down without the risk of releasing chemicals or irritants into the air. This not only helps to maintain a healthier living environment but also prolongs the lifespan of the couch.
